  3. First Lieutenant Lindquist was a member of Company H, 3rd Battalion, 1st Marines, 1st Marine Division. He was listed as Missing in Action while fighting the enemy at Hill 111, known as the Boulder City outpost and the last ground action by the Marines in the Korean War, on July 25, 1953.

  4. Second Lieutenant Carl Ellsworth Lindquist Jr. entered the U.S. Marine Corps from New Jersey and served in H Company, 3rd Battalion, 1st Marine Regiment, 1st Marine Division. He was the leader of a patrol that was going to be sent to Hill 111 on July 25, 1953, but had gone to the hill on July 24 in order to familiarize himself with the terrain.
